"Oracle命令大全包含了Oracle数据库的常用操作语句,旨在帮助用户熟悉并掌握Oracle的日常管理。文档内容涵盖三大主题:Oracle基本操作语句、SQLServer基本操作语句和各种数据库连接方法。"
在Oracle基本操作语句部分,学习者将了解如何管理Oracle服务和监听器。开启服务器的命令是`net start oracleservice`,这会启动指定的Oracle服务。监听器是数据库通信的关键,可以通过`lsnrctl start`命令启动。相反,关闭服务器的命令是`net stop oracleservicebinbo`,而停止监听器则使用`lsnrctl stop`。
对于日常操作中的清理屏幕,你可以使用清屏命令,虽然在Oracle命令行中通常使用`clear screen`或`cls`,但具体可能因终端环境不同而略有差异。
数据字典是Oracle数据库的重要组成部分,用于存储关于数据库对象的信息。例如,`desc user_views`命令可以显示用户视图的详细描述,帮助理解其结构和属性。
查询权限是数据库管理员的常见任务。在Oracle中,查看当前用户的角色,可以使用`SELECT * FROM user_role_privs`。若想了解用户所具有的系统权限和表级权限,可以分别执行`SELECT * FROM user_sys_privs`和`SELECT * FROM user_tab_privs`。
此外,确定用户默认的表空间也是很有用的,特别是当管理存储时。通过`SELECT username, default_tablespace FROM user_users`,可以查看每个用户的默认表空间设置。
在数据库访问方面,切换用户是常有的操作。在Oracle中,可以使用`conn as sysdba`命令以SYSDBA角色连接,例如`conn sys/tsinghua`,这里"sys"是用户名,"tsinghua"是密码(实际生产环境中应谨慎处理敏感信息)。
总结来说,这份Oracle命令大全提供了全面的指南,不仅包含服务器管理和权限查询,还涉及数据字典查询以及用户管理,是学习和日常使用Oracle数据库不可或缺的参考资料。通过深入学习和实践这些命令,用户能够更有效地管理Oracle环境。